Comprehending the Spanish Pharmacy System (Farmacia)
In Spain, the distribution of pharmaceuticals is heavily controlled to make sure consumer safety. Unlike in some nations where a large range of medications can be purchased in corner store or supermarkets, most effective over-the-counter (OTC) pain relief items need to be bought at a registered pharmacy, identifiable by a glowing green cross.
Pharmacies in Spain fall into 2 categories:
- Physical Brick-and-Mortar Pharmacies (Farmacias): Ubiquitous in every community, staffed by well-informed, university-trained pharmacists who can offer standard medical recommendations in emergency situations.
- Online Pharmacias: Legitimate, physical drug stores authorized by the Spanish government to offer specific non-prescription medications online.
Typical Categories of Pain Relief Available
When looking to purchase pain relief items in Spain, it helps to know the generic and trademark name typically requested.
- Mild Analgesics: Used mainly for headaches, fevers, and small aches.
- Non-Steroidal Anti-Inflammatory Drugs (NSAIDs): Ideal for joint pain, muscle swelling, and menstrual cramps.
- Topical Treatments: Creams, gels, and patches used directly to the site of musculoskeletal pain.
Typical Pain Relief Options in SpainClassificationGeneric NameCommon Spanish BrandsTypical UsePrescription Needed?Mild AnalgesicParacetamolGelocatil, EfferalganFever, headachesNoNSAIDIbuprofenoAlgidrin, NurofenSwelling, muscle painNo (for standard 400mg dosages)NSAID/ AnalgesicDexketoprofenoEnantyumIntense moderate painYes (typically)Topical GelDiclofenacoVoltarénJoint pain, sprainsNoMuscle RelaxantMetocarbamol/ ParacetamolRobaxisalExtreme muscle convulsionsYes
Note: While 400mg Ibuprofen is readily available over the counter in Spain, greater does (such as 600mg) strictly need a medical professional's prescription.
How to Order Pain Relief Products Online in Spain
Ordering medications online has become progressively convenient. Nevertheless, due to strict EU and Spanish regulations, consumers can not just buy medications from any e-commerce website.
Step-by-Step Guide to Safe Online Ordering
- Verify the Website: Ensure the online store is an authorized Spanish drug store. Look for the official EU common logo design for online drug stores at the footer of the website-- clicking it needs to reroute you to the main government windows registry.
- Develop an Account: Most online pharmacies need a brief registration to track orders and make sure responsibility.
- Browse and Select: Choose the appropriate OTC pain relief item. Read the product leaflet (Prospecto) offered digitally on the website.
- Checkout and Delivery: Choose between home delivery or local pickup (Click & & Collect). Standard shipping within mainland Spain normally takes 24 to 72 hours.

Tips for Buying Pain Relief Products Safely
Whether acquiring online or strolling into a local farmacia, following finest practices ensures safety and effectiveness.
- Consult the Pharmacist: Spanish pharmacists undergo rigorous medical training. If unsure which item matches specific symptoms, explain the pain to the pharmacist ("Tengo dolor de ..."). They can assist you toward the proper dose and solution.
- Watch the Dosage: Spanish formulas-- particularly of Ibuprofen-- historically favored higher dosages (such as 600mg). Always adhere strictly to the advised dose on the packaging or advised by a professional. Combining medications without assistance can cause adverse negative effects.
- Inspect Expiry Dates and Packaging: Ensure that any item bought online shows up in unopened, tamper-evident product packaging with clear expiration dates and Spanish labeling.
- Know When to See a Doctor: OTC pain relievers are created for short-term management of moderate to moderate signs.
